SPP&ID training likely refers to SPP (Smart Process Plant) and P&ID (Piping and Instrumentation Diagram) training. P&ID is a crucial part of process design, used to represent the mechanical, electrical, and instrumentation components of a system. It is widely used in industries like chemical engineering, oil and gas, and manufacturing.

  • Tools and Technologies Covered

    • SmartPlant P&ID (SPPID): Core software for P&ID design and data management.
    • Smart 3D: Integration with 3D plant design.
    • Smart Materials: Integration for material management.
    • SmartPlant Foundation (SPF): For data management and collaboration.
    • Microsoft Excel: For report generation and data management.
